Es gibt viele Gründe, warum Sie in WordPress suchen und ersetzen müssen. Es könnte sein, dass der Artikel, den Sie auf Ihrem mobilen Gerät geschrieben haben, viele Tippfehler aufweist (aufgrund der Autokorrekturfunktion Ihrer Tastatur) und Sie alle mit einem Suchen und Ersetzen reparieren möchten. Alternativ könnte es sein, dass du deine Datenbank aktualisiert hast oder zu einem neuen Webhost gewechselt bist, und in deinen Posts tauchen seltsame Charaktere auf. Unabhängig von der Situation ist es immer praktisch, eine Suchfunktion in WordPress zu haben. Die meisten Textdepots kommen mit dieser Funktion, also warum nicht WordPress?

Schaltfläche Suchen und Ersetzen im WordPress Post Editor

Wenn Sie nur eine Schaltfläche zum Suchen / Ersetzen im Post-Editor hinzufügen müssen, damit Sie die Tippfehler in diesem Artikel beheben können, ist TinyMCE Advanced das beste Plugin, das Sie verwenden können.

Nach der Installation können Sie unter "Einstellungen -> TinytMCE Advanced" nach einer Liste von Schaltflächen suchen, die Sie dem Post-Editor hinzufügen können. Eine davon ist die Schaltfläche "Suchen / Ersetzen". Ziehe dieses Symbol in das Editor-Menü und klicke auf "Änderungen speichern".

Als nächstes gehen Sie zu Ihrem Post-Editor, und Sie sollten in der Symbolleiste das Symbol "Suchen / Ersetzen" finden. Das sehen Sie, wenn Sie darauf klicken:

Zu ähnlichen Plugins, die Sie verwenden können, gehören WP Edit und WP Super Edit.

Suchen und Ersetzen von Text in allen Posts / Seiten / benutzerdefinierten Post-Typ

Wenn der Fehler, den Sie korrigieren, in allen Posts oder Seiten auftritt, ist das Ersetzen-Plug-in für Suchen das Richtige für Sie. Was es tut, ist die Suche durch alle Ihre Beiträge / Seiten / benutzerdefinierte Post-Typen für die Such-String und ersetzt sie durch die korrigierte Zeichenfolge. Dies ist besonders nützlich, wenn Sie auf eine neue Domain migrieren und alle Links von der alten Domain zur neuen URL ändern möchten.

Nach der Installation finden Sie das Tool im Bereich "Plugins -> Suchen und Ersetzen". Eine gute Sache über dieses Plugin ist, dass außer Post-Inhalt, kann es Postmeta-Wert ändern.

Suchen und Ersetzen von Werten in der Datenbank

Anstelle von Text im Post-Inhalt müssen Sie, wenn Sie einen Site-weiten Wert ändern, einschließlich Plugin-Einstellungen, Systemeinstellungen usw., die Datenbank direkt bearbeiten. Zum Glück gibt es dafür ein Werkzeug. Das Search and Replace-Plugin ermöglicht es Ihnen, Strings in Ihrer WordPress-Datenbank zu finden und sie durch eine andere Zeichenfolge zu ersetzen. Sie können in ID, Post-Content, GUID, Titel, Auszug, Metadaten, Kommentare, Kommentar-Autor, Kommentar-E-Mail, Kommentar-URL, Tags / Kategorien und Kategorien-Beschreibung suchen. Es ist auch möglich, die Benutzer-ID in allen Tabellen und die Benutzeranmeldung zu ersetzen. Wie Sie sehen, ist dies ein mächtiges Werkzeug, und jeder Fehler, den Sie machen, könnte Ihre WordPress-Datenbank beschädigen. Verwenden Sie dies nur, wenn Sie wissen, was Sie tun, und sichern Sie Ihre Datenbank, bevor Sie fortfahren.

Gehen Sie nach der Installation zu "Extras -> Suchen & Ersetzen". Es gibt zwei Optionen: Sie können eine "Alle Suche (und ersetzen)" auswählen oder die zu durchsuchende und zu ersetzende Datenbanktabelle auswählen. Bei der Suche wird zwischen Groß- und Kleinschreibung unterschieden, und es gibt keine Mustervergleichsfunktionen. Sie können zuerst eine Suche durchführen, ohne sie zu ersetzen, und sicherstellen, dass die Daten, die Sie ersetzen, korrekt sind. Danach können Sie eine Suche durchführen und ersetzen.

Beachten Sie, dass das Search & Replace-Plugin keine serialisierten Daten durchsucht. Technisch bedeutet dies, dass, wenn ein Plugin seine Daten im Array-Format speichert, sein Wert nicht durch "Suchen und Ersetzen" geändert werden kann. Es wird nur der Textwert gesucht und ersetzt.

Fazit

Abhängig vom Grad der Such- und Ersetzungsfunktion, die Sie ausführen möchten, steht Ihnen ein Plugin zur Verfügung. Die letzte Methode, die Sie verwenden können, ist, den Datenbankwert direkt über phpmyadmin zu ändern, aber das ist zu technisch und wird nicht für jeden empfohlen. Lassen Sie uns wissen, wenn Sie auf ein anderes nützliches Plugin zum Suchen und Ersetzen stoßen, das oben nicht erwähnt wurde.

Bildnachweis: tango edit find replace